A Natural Pesticide


The women lost most of their last crop from their Square Foot Gardens in this last season from the caterpillars and crickets. We tried several different natural pesticides like tobacco and garlic, with no success. Just recently, we discovered that the chiltepes (tiny wild hot peppers) can be boiled for 10 minutes and let to stand for 3 days to produce a very smelly but very effective natural pesticide.
